Benang Kelambu Waterfall



Benang Kelambu Waterfall located in Pemotoh Hamlet, Aiq Beriq Village, North Batukliang District, Central Lombok Regency, West Nusa Tenggara, Indonesia. This waterfall is about 55 kilometers from Lombok International Airport and can be reached in about an hour. From Mataram, the distance is about 30 kilometers with an estimated travel time of an hour. Located in the Rinjani Geopark area, this waterfall is recognized by UNESCO as a World Earth Park.

Asian Destinations Readers, do you know that there is a myth circulating that says that the Benang Kelambu Waterfall is able to make you stay young, bring blessings, and safety. It is also mentioned that the Benang Kelambu Waterfall was once used as a place for sacred people. In addition, there is a legend that says that Benang Kelambu Waterfall is still closely related as the bathing place for Dewi Anjani, a supernatural being who is believed to be the guardian of Mount Rinjani. According to a growing legend, Dewi Anjani will come down at a certain time and bathe and clean her hair in this place.

This waterfall comes from many springs that come out through gaps along the cliff. However, the cliff that was covered with lush vegetation looked as if water was coming out of it. That's why it's called the Yarn Kelambu Waterfall. A thin layer of white waterfall looks so charming, just like a dangling mosquito net. The interesting thing is that you can drink the water directly, because the water comes directly from the spring.
